Output bdbf80b0eaecc493e89b57a9773c2f94a1a1d6aec424d5b63880a0769ec8ccb6:1

value
486283509
script pubkey
OP_0 OP_PUSHBYTES_20 84ba14f37bc4f32af7c49b69917af44edc42faf7
address
bc1qsjapfummcnej4a7ynd5ez7h5fmwy97hhuqpf7w
transaction
bdbf80b0eaecc493e89b57a9773c2f94a1a1d6aec424d5b63880a0769ec8ccb6
confirmations
404047
spent
true